Sanusi Speaks On Kano LG Election

🔊 Listen To Post

The Emir of Kano, Muhammadu Sanusi II, has urged eligible voters in the state to participate in Saturday’s Local Government elections and choose their preferred candidates.

Speaking to reporters at his palace on Friday, he highlighted the need to avoid violence and any actions that could disrupt the electoral process.

He called on residents to maintain peace and refrain from violent behavior before, during, and after the elections.

Mr. Sanusi also urged parents to prevent their children from being used as agents of chaos and advised the community to ignore any miscreants looking to incite trouble.

He encouraged cooperation with the Kano State Independent Electoral Commission to ensure a smooth electoral process.
